Performance
| Max speed |
316 kph (195.92 mph) |
| 0 - 40 kph |
1.2 s |
| 0 - 50 kph |
1.5 s |
| 0 - 80 kph |
3.0 s |
| 0 - 100 kph |
3.7 s |
| 0 - 130 kph |
5.8 s |
| 0 - 180 kph |
10.5 s |
| 0 - 200 kph |
11.8 s |
| 0 - 250 kph |
20.1 s |
| 0 - 300 kph |
38.7 s |
| 0 - 60 mph |
3.4 s |
| 0 - 100 mph |
7.6 s |
| 0 - 150 mph |
20.0 s |
| 1000 m |
22.2 s @ 240 kph |
| 1/4 mile |
11.5 s |
Engine
| Power |
386 kw (518 bhp / 525 ps) @ 8000 rpm |
| Torque |
530 Nm (392 lb-ft) @ 6500 rpm |
| Displacement |
5.2 liters (318 ci) |
| Engine type |
V10 40v DOHC FSI |
| Engine location |
middle |
General data
| Gearbox |
6 speed manual or 6 speed R-Tronic |
| Drive |
all wheel drive |
| Fuel capacity |
90 l |
| Year of introduction |
2009 |
| Home country |
Germany |
Dimensions
| Curb weight |
1620 kg (3564 lbs) + |
| Size |
4.44 m (175 in) long, 1.93 m (76 in) wide and 1.25 m (49 in) high |
| Wheelbase |
2.65 m (104.3 in) |
| Track width |
1.64 m (64.5 in) front, 1.6 m (62.8 in) rear |
